This book (1) integrates artificial intelligence into modeling, evaluation, and optimization of building systems, enabling multi-scale and multi-objective analysis; (2) uncovers the underlying mechanisms and interdependencies influencing building energy, comfort, and carbon performance across spatial and temporal dimensions; (3) presents cutting-edge analytical and optimization methods that support data-informed design, diagnosis, and operation; and (4) demonstrates the applicability and scalability of AI techniques through representative case studies and methodological examples. By uniting theoretical advancement with practical implementation, this book offers both a scientific foundation and a reference guide for researchers, engineers, and policymakers striving to enhance the intelligence, efficiency, and sustainability of the built environment.
